Origins of the Surname 'November'

The surname 'November' is believed to have originated from the Latin word "novem," which means "nine." In ancient Rome, November was the ninth month of the year in the original Roman calendar, and this name has since been passed down as a surname in some regions. The use of months or seasons as surnames was common in many cultures, reflecting the importance of time and the natural world in people's lives.
